The club at Main will discuss The Annotated Pride & Prejudice by Jane Austen when it meets at 6 p.m. Tuesday, March 25. The Main Branch is located at 1740 Central Ave. To find out more about that group, call Amanda Clark at (606) 329-0518, ext. 1140.

The Summit club is reading Oh, Kentucky! by Betty Layman Receveur. There are two chances to participate at Summit: 11 a.m. or 5 p.m. (the same book is discussed each time). The branch is located at 1016 Summit Road. To find out more, call Allison Scarberry at (606) 928-3366.

The Catlettsburg club will meet next on Tuesday, April 8, at 5 p.m.. Members will discuss The Boy in Striped Pajamas by John Boyne. For more information, call Lisa Epling at (606) 739-8332.
